On Friday 18th March 2016, the Education for Sustainable Development in Higher Education Topic Support Network met to discuss the sustainability programmes and modules which exist in Scotland, and how they fit within individual disciplines or between them.Presenters from a range of universities were invited to share the modules or programmes they are involved with which have an interdisciplinary sustainability focus, including details of any innovative assessments or practical projects. Challenges and opportunities for education for sustainable development in the Scottish higher education sector were then discussed.
